1.5-W 520 nm continuous-wave output from a 50 μm/0.22NA fiber-coupled laser diode module

2021 
In this paper, a high brightness fiber-coupled module with a central wavelength of 520 nm is simulated and designed by ray-tracing software ZEMAX and then is experimentally implemented. Three 1-W continuous-wave green LD single emitters based on TO-9-package are successively collimated, spatially combined, and focused into an optical fiber with a core diameter of 50 μm and a numerical aperture of 0.22. The final output power of 1.53 W is obtained, corresponding to an optical–optical conversion efficiency of 51% and an electro-optical conversion efficiency of 10%. The tolerances between the simulation and the experimental result are analyzed and explained.
